OverviewFrench Hospital Medical Center, located in San Luis Obispo, California, has been named one of the Nations 100 Top Hospitals by Truven Health Analytics and is rated among the top hospitals in the nation for cardiac, orthopedic, and GI services. French Hospital has achieved the prestigious designation as a Primary Stroke Center by the Joint Commission. The Copeland, Forbes, and Rossi Cardiac Care Center provides the latest innovative cardiac and imaging technology. The hospital is also home to the unique Hearst Cancer Resource Center offering free education, resources, and support to cancer patients and their families. French Hospital Medical Center is a part of Dignity Healths Southern California Division and is a member of CommonSpirit Health, the largest not-for-profit health care system in the nation, boasting an integrated network of top quality hospitals, with physicians from the most prestigious medical schools, and comprehensive outpatient services - all recognized for quality, safety, and service. Each hospital is supported by an active philanthropic Foundation to help meet the growing health care needs of our communities. To learn more go to ResponsibilitiesAbout This PositionIn keeping with French Hospital Medical Center health care philosophy, the Operating Room Clinical Nurse is an experienced practitioner who demonstrates in-depth knowledge of nursing and patient care, and has the ability to practice independently at French Hospital and applicable entities. The OR Clinical Nurse also serves as a resource person as well as a preceptor. Under minimal supervision, the OR Clinical Nurse identifies and implements nursing interventions for patients and evaluates the results of these interventions for a given patient population. Supports and promotes the provision of quality patient care. Demonstrates ability to circulate on all surgical procedures performed at French Hospital.RN Selection CriteriaGraduate of accredited RN School of Nursing Currently licensed by the State of California as a Registered Nurse.
